Market Overview

Mobile Virtual Network Operators (MVNOs) are telecommunications service providers that do not own the wireless infrastructure but lease capacity from traditional Mobile Network Operators (MNOs) to offer mobile services to their customers. The MVNO business model has transformed the mobile telecom industry by introducing innovative service offerings, competitive pricing, and personalized customer experiences.

Key market drivers include:

  • Cost Advantage: MVNOs typically offer more affordable mobile plans than traditional operators, attracting price-sensitive customers.
  • Niche Market Targeting: MVNOs often serve specific demographics such as ethnic communities, seniors, youth, or businesses with specialized communication needs.
  • Technological Innovations: The adoption of 5G, IoT (Internet of Things), and eSIM technologies has opened new revenue streams and enhanced service capabilities for MVNOs.
  • Regulatory Support: Favorable telecom regulations and policies in many regions encourage MVNO market entry, promoting competition and consumer choice.

However, the MVNO market also faces challenges such as dependency on MNOs for network access, pricing pressures, and intense competition from both traditional carriers and Over-The-Top (OTT) service providers.

Market Segmentation

The Mobile Virtual Network Operator market can be segmented based on type of MVNOend-user, and service type:

  1. By Type of MVNO
  • Branded Reseller MVNOs: These MVNOs resell services under their own brand but rely heavily on the MNO for network management and customer care.
  • Full MVNOs: These operators manage their own core network functions, including billing and customer service, while leasing only radio access from MNOs.
  • Light MVNOs: Operate with limited infrastructure, focusing on marketing and customer acquisition, while outsourcing most network and operational services.
  • Enhanced Service Providers (ESP): Offer additional services such as content, value-added services, or customer loyalty programs to differentiate their offerings.
  1. By End-User
  • Consumer Segment: Includes individual mobile users opting for prepaid or postpaid plans, driven by affordability and flexible usage.
  • Enterprise Segment: Businesses seeking tailored mobile communication solutions for their workforce and IoT-enabled devices.
  • Machine-to-Machine (M2M) / IoT Segment: MVNOs increasingly cater to IoT applications in sectors such as automotive, healthcare, and smart cities.
  1. By Service Type
  • Voice Services: Traditional voice calling services remain a fundamental offering.
  • Data Services: High-speed internet connectivity and data-centric packages are major growth drivers.
  • Value-Added Services: Messaging, mobile TV, cloud storage, and other supplementary offerings help MVNOs attract and retain customers.

Key Companies in the MVNO Market

The MVNO market is characterized by a mix of specialized MVNO operators and telecom companies launching their own virtual brands. Prominent players include:

  • Virgin Mobile: A global MVNO brand operating in multiple countries with strong consumer recognition.
  • Lebara: Known for targeting expatriate and immigrant communities with competitive international calling plans.
  • Mint Mobile: A U.S.-based MVNO focused on affordable prepaid plans and digital-first customer experience.
  • TracFone Wireless: One of the largest MVNOs in the U.S., operating multiple brands such as Straight Talk and Net10.
  • Telecom Italia’s Kena Mobile: An example of an MNO launching an MVNO to capture budget-conscious customers.
  • Lycamobile: A global MVNO catering to international and multicultural customers with affordable global roaming.
  • Consumer Cellular: Focused on senior citizens with user-friendly plans and excellent customer service.
  • Amaysim (Australia): A leading MVNO offering simple, flexible mobile plans with a strong digital presence.
  • Jio Virtual Network Operator (India): Emerging MVNO operators in India leveraging massive smartphone penetration and low-cost data plans.

These companies continuously innovate by introducing competitive tariffs, flexible plans, and enhanced customer engagement strategies to gain market share.

Market Trends and Future Outlook

Several key trends are shaping the future trajectory of the MVNO market:

  • 5G and IoT Integration: MVNOs are expanding their offerings to support 5G-enabled devices and IoT connectivity, enabling new use cases in smart homes, connected cars, and industrial automation.
  • eSIM Technology: The adoption of embedded SIM cards simplifies MVNO onboarding and switching, boosting consumer flexibility.
  • Digital-Only MVNOs: Purely digital MVNOs leveraging app-based customer management and AI-driven support are gaining popularity.
  • Focus on Customer Experience: Personalization, loyalty programs, and value-added content are crucial for customer retention amid rising competition.
  • Collaborations and Partnerships: MVNOs are partnering with OTT service providers, content platforms, and fintech companies to bundle mobile services with entertainment and financial products.
